WebJun 22, 2024 · The Refinery is located on 5,050-acres approximately one-mile northwest of Delaware City, Delaware. The refining operations occupy about 1,000-acres. The facility commenced operation in 1956. The facility processed a variety of crude oils and currently produces about 180,000 barrels of petroleum product a day.
